About Odebolt, IA

Odebolt is a small community located in Iowa with a population of 905 residents according to the latest US Census Bureau American Community Survey data. The median household income is $54,914 per year, which is 27% below the national median of $75,149. The median age of 55.3 years is notably older the US median age of 38.9 years, suggesting a more established community with a higher proportion of long-term residents.

Housing Market Overview

The housing market in Odebolt features a median home value of $98,100, which is 60% below the national median of $244,900. This makes Odebolt one of the more affordable markets in the country, potentially attractive for first-time homebuyers. Median monthly rent is $499, 57% below the national average of $1,163/month. Of the 496 total housing units, 76% are owner-occupied (312 units) and 24% are renter-occupied (98 units). The high homeownership rate suggests a stable, established residential community.

Economy & Employment

The local economy in Odebolt shows an unemployment rate of 4.4%, which is near the national rate of 3.7%. The poverty rate stands at 8.3%, below the national average of 12.4%, reflecting generally favorable economic conditions. Workers in Odebolt have an average one-way commute time of 17.4 minutes, one of the shorter commutes in the region.

Cost of Living in Odebolt, IA

Compared to national averages, Odebolt has a median household income of $54,914 (27% below the national median of $75,149). Home values average $98,100, which is 60% below the national median. Monthly rent at $499 is 57% below the US average of $1,163. Within Iowa, Odebolt's income is 19% below the state average of $67,947, and home values are 26% below the state median of $132,237.
